If you’re looking for a grim dive with barely a pulse, this place has it in spades. The draw? Fifteen poker machines and the grey haze of Welfare Check Day. There are three bars, but only one actually serves drinks, with the other two practically abandoned. The crowd? Mostly regulars glued to their screens, feeding in cash faster than you can say “depressing.” A couple of locals might approach for a chat, stories tinged with a heaviness that lingers long after you’ve left. Cash only and cheap beer reign supreme here.
